Summary

Authorizing the Attorney General to seek injunctive relief on behalf of the State on the basis of an imminent or ongoing violation of certain rights of residents of certain health care facilities; requiring that the resident bill of rights for assisted living program residents include certain rights; and prohibiting the Attorney General from duplicating certain corrective action by the Maryland Department of Health.

Title

Office of the Attorney General - Rights of Residents of Health Care Facilities - Injunctive Relief
